French polished slate and scagliola marble mantel clock, circa 1870, the barrel clock case enclosing a white enamelled dial with Roman numerals, visible brocot escapement, signed 'C Detouche, Paris', the movement signed 'Detouche', striking on a bell, the gridiron pendulum visible through a bevelled glass lenticle, flanked by polished slate brackets, over a plinth base, width 42.5cm, height 43cm
